The size of Annandale is approximately 1.5 square kilometres. There are 14 parks, covering nearly 7.0% of the total area. The population of Annandale in 2016 was 9451 people. By 2021 the population was 9487 showing a population growth of 0.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Annandale is 30-39 years. Households in Annandale are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Annandale work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 56.40% of the homes in Annandale were owner-occupied compared with 54.30% in 2016.
